Spiritual Short

Recognizing daily blessings

From the October 2022 issue of The Christian Science Journal


Recently I met with a university student for ten weeks as part of her class assignment to interact with a senior citizen. She shared how she loved her theology class, and I shared how I love the Bible and the book that makes it so practical—Science and Health with Key to the Scriptures by Mary Baker Eddy. I offered her a copy of the book, and she asked what it was about. It was a great opportunity for me to consider the book’s importance.

The Christian Science textbook guides us in learning, understanding, and demonstrating the spiritual laws that prove God is the source of all health. It defines God and our relationship to God. It shows how sin, sickness, disease, and death are no part of God’s creation. It teaches how to pray, follow Christ Jesus’ teachings, and heal as he instructed his followers to do.

When I shared this: “To those leaning on the sustaining infinite, to-day is big with blessings” (Science and Health, p. vii), the young woman’s reply of, “Wow, that’s deep!” awakened me to the importance of recognizing these daily blessings.
